>> BTW: I'm not sure if there is any reasonable benefit for
>> `org-mode-p', anyway.  Checking the rest of the emacs source tree,
>> then the convention is to either use
>> 
>>  (eq major-mode 'foo-mode)
>> 
>> or
>> 
>>  (derived-mode-p 'foo-mode)
>> 
>> depending on what's needed.  I don't see why (org-mode-p) or even
>> (org-mode-p 'derived) is clearer...
>
> I agree, it is not clearer, only a bit more compact.  I don't think we
> should have a new function here.  Just make a patch that used
> derived-mode-p in places where this is needed.  I would accept such a
> patch.

Ups, I've slightly misread your suggestion.  Currently, there is only
one place in org-src.el that check for being a mode derived from
org-mode or org-mode itself.  The second is useless, because
(derived-mode-p 'org-mode) is true for org-mode, too.
